Philly-Based Brand Agency, 20nine, Announces Acquisition Of Brand Incubator, Nucleus Brands, And Hiring Of Jason Weidner As COO

PHILADELPHIA — January 23, 2019 — Philly-based creative brand agency 20nine continues to build on its commitment to purpose-driven branding and delivering full circle solutions by acquiring Nucleus Brands and naming its CEO, Jason Weidner, as 20nine’s COO.

“Today’s consumers are expecting brands to be more purpose-driven and deliver higher-order value to society,” said Greg Ricciardi, President/CEO, 20nine. “Acquiring Nucleus accelerates our ability to build brands with more meaning for clients and brands of our own. 20nine has always been entrepreneurial in nature so this makes total sense.”

Nucleus Brands is a portfolio of Direct-to-Consumer brands, living at the intersection of smart product development and strategic marketing. The mission is to leverage ecommerce as the main distribution channel, while creating value for customers in high demand categories with opportunity for innovation. These products inspire consumers to share their experience with others and proudly represent the brand as a reflection of themselves.

By adding this capability, 20nine enhances its offering of brand development, digital marketing, social media, product design and development, to now deliver a high value platform that completes the full circle, from concept, to bring-to-market strategy, to operationalizing it in the digital age.

“We’re excited to engage with clients who are committed to bringing a greater sense of purpose and meaning to the brands they sell but also to continue building purpose-first brands of our own,” said Jason Weidner, COO, 20nine. “Nucleus home-grown brands will continue to be developed under the flag of the new brand incubator that includes Waggery (pet products), Freetown (lifestyle apparel) and Matsy (home goods).”
